Parotid abscess
Parotid abscess is a disease of the oral cavity, it is the formation of a delimited inflammatory site, the formation of a cavity filled with pus in it. There is an abscess in the jaw area. If you do not go to the doctor, the inflammation can spread to the surrounding tissues and organs – bones, organs of the nasal cavity and mouth – this is how phlegmon develops. It is possible to eliminate the focus of inflammation only surgically.
reasons
The cause of the development of inflammation is the penetration and reproduction of conditionally pathogenic flora – staphylococci and streptococci. Most often this happens with the advanced course of oral diseases – caries, gingivitis, stomatitis and other diseases. Also, chronic tonsillitis, sore throat, tuberculosis, aseptic disorders in dental treatment can become a cause.
Lymphagenic and hematogenic pathogens can penetrate from other inflammatory areas if they are present. Diseases such as furunculosis, candidiasis and others.
Injuries with a violation of the integrity of the skin and surrounding tissues can lead to the formation of an abscess of the maxillofacial zone.
symptoms
The parotid abscess is accompanied by pain, which resembles dental pain in nature. The pain can reach a very strong intensity, especially if the abscess develops in the immediate vicinity of the nerve endings. The pain can be aching, stabbing, throbbing or tearing in nature. The patient refuses to eat, his appetite decreases. In addition to pain, the patient complains of an increase in temperature, a visual defect – with shallow abscesses, an infiltrate can be seen with the naked eye, the skin above it is hyperemic, edematous, local fever. In some cases, the infiltrate can break out or into the internal tissues of the body, followed by suppuration. When an abscess is opened, the cavity of the abscess, sometimes bone, teeth, is exposed to the outside.
When an abscess is located on the bottom or palate of the oral cavity, problems arise not only with eating, but also with speech, since tongue movements bring severe pain to a person.

Treatment depends on the stage of development of the abscess. A diet is necessarily prescribed, food is served barely warm in a pureed form, liquid. If it is impossible to take food, the patient is transferred to parenteral nutrition.
An unopened abscess is opened, the cavity is drained, general and local antibacterial therapy is prescribed. If the abscess has just begun to develop, it is not opened, treatment is based only on drug therapy and diet.
In addition to antibiotics, the patient is prescribed vitamin therapy, immunostimulants. Comprehensive treatment, diagnosis and prevention of major diseases are carried out, complete sanitation of the oral cavity is shown. In order to reduce swelling, it is recommended to rinse your mouth.
Analgesic drugs are prescribed only for severe pain syndrome. As a rule, the duration of treatment of an abscess reaches no more than 14 days.
In complex neglected cases, emergency surgical interventions are performed.
